Weather in June

The first month of the summer, June, is still a hot month in Kokoro, Benin, with temperature in the range of an average low of 21.9°C (71.4°F) and an average high of 31°C (87.8°F).

Temperature

Upon the beginning of June, Kokoro's high-temperatures register at a still tropical 31°C (87.8°F), closely mirroring the preceding month. During the nights in June, Kokoro experiences a consistent average temperature of 21.9°C (71.4°F).

Heat index

In June, the heat index is estimated at an extremely hot 41°C (105.8°F). Take more caution, heat exhaustion and heat cramps may occur. Long-lasting activity may cause heatstroke.
Heat index readings emphasize conditions of light breezes and shaded spots. Exposure to direct sunshine can increase heat index values by up to 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'apparent temperature' or 'feels like', is a single figure representing how weather conditions feel when combining temperature and humidity. This effect is subjective, differing among individuals based on their physical activity and perception of heat, which can be influenced by factors like wind, clothing, and metabolic variances. Direct sunlight can potentially raise the heat index by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ees, so it's crucial to consider. Heat index values are extremely significant for children. Children usually face more risks than adults as their ability to sweat is less. Additionally, their larger skin surface in relation to their petite bodies and higher heat output due to their activities increases their vulnerability.
The body's natural response to excessive warmth is perspiration, as it allows for cooling through sweat evaporation. When the air holds a significant amount of moisture, the efficiency of the evaporation process is decreased, preventing the body from cooling down efficiently, leading to the sensation of overheating. As the body gains more heat than it can dissipate, there's a risk of increasing temperatures and resultant overheating.

Humidity

In Kokoro, the average relative humidity in June is 79%.

Rainfall

In Kokoro, in June, during 15.8 rainfall days, 57mm (2.24") of precipitation is typically accumulated. In Kokoro, during the entire year, the rain falls for 155.6 days and collects up to 568mm (22.36") of precipitation.

Daylight

June has the longest days of the year in Kokoro, with an average of 12h and 36min of daylight.
On the first day of June in Kokoro, Benin, sunrise is at 06:30 and sunset at 19:04.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 06:35 and sunset at 19:11 WAT.

Sunshine

In Kokoro, the average sunshine in June is 8h.

UV index

In Kokoro, the average daily maximum UV index in June is 6. A UV Index value of 6 to 7 symbolizes a high health hazard from exposure to the Sun's UV rays for ordinary individuals.
